(a) At t = 0, without prior information, we select a random
curve among the red candidate curves based on their likelihood. The thicker the
curve, the higher posterior probability it has. (b) By solving the Frenet-Serret
ODE, we propagate by Δs. (c) At t = 1,
we calculate the prior probability for candidate curves for a smooth transition
from the previous curve shown in green. (d) Propagate to
p2.
